# Service Accounts — Tariffwright Rules Engine

The Tariffwright engine evaluates shipping-fee rules for all Cartonbay storefronts. It runs under the `svc-tariffwright` account, which has read access to the rate tables and write access to the fee-audit log only. Do not grant it broader scopes; rule deployments go through the Ledgate pipeline instead. Rotation happens quarterly via the Keysmith job. For local testing against the staging engine, the service account authenticates with the following key.

service key, fawip-bajef: kto11_Qt5wZK9vdNC

Ticket for weekly sync: drift on Paylark's idempotency-key settings.

So, fun one — retry storms on Thursday turned out to be config drift: two payment workers had a shorter key TTL than the rest, so retries minted fresh keys and double-charged a handful of test accounts (caught in sandbox, thankfully). We need everyone on the same values and an alert when they diverge. The intended settings are below for reference.

config for bawig-fadup:
[zorix]
host = zorix.lumicworks.corp
user = zorix_svc
database = zorix_prod

Reviewed the proposed JV with Thornmere Logistics. Capital commitment is manageable; payback modeled at 30 months. Revenue split favors us in years one and two, flips thereafter. Key risks: overlapping territories in the Calden basin and unclear exit terms. Legal is redrafting the termination clause. Sales impact: expect channel overlap with the Renfield accounts to be resolved before signing. Recommendation is conditional approval pending revised terms. The confidential note below is restricted to this distribution.

board note of bawep-tajef: Queniusek Systems plans to raise the Quenvan list price by 53.1 percent in March. The pricing group signed off on a budget of $176.4 million for Project Drueth. The renewal with Casionix Partners closes at $142.5 million a year, 8.3 percent below the last contract. Project Fraax slips by six weeks because of the tooling delay.

## Approvals: Vendoring Third-Party Fonts

Before vendoring any font into the Quillmark repo, contractors must verify the license permits redistribution, record it in the licenses manifest, and strip unused glyph subsets. No font lands on main without a documented approval. The approver responsible for all font-vendoring requests is listed below.

account owner for tawef-yadug: Jorius Normir Silath